Severe storms will threaten parts of the South and Southeast on Sunday. Damaging winds, hail and the possibility of a brief tornado will be possible. While rain will be beneficial in parts of the Southeast, heavy rain could lead to the threat of flash flooding in some locations. Watch this video for the latest update.
